What Are RTA Closets?
RTA stands for Ready-To-Assemble. These closets come in flat packs, requiring some DIY assembly. They’re the perfect blend of convenience and affordability, resembling flat-pack furniture that many have come to love.
Unlike traditional closets built on-site, RTA closets are pre-manufactured and packaged to highlight the ease of construction. You only need some basic tools and a little patience.

Designing Your RTA Closet
The world of RTA closets offers numerous design possibilities. You can play around with various shelves, hanging rods, drawers, and shoe racks to build a closet that suits your lifestyle. The goal is to tailor the space to fit your needs while keeping the aesthetic both appealing and practical.
Popular Styles and Finishes
From sleek modern designs to rustic charm, the possibilities with RTA closets are endless. White, wood grain, and even vibrant colors are among the popular choices. Finishes like matte or glossy add the extra touch of personality to your closet. Choose a style that resonates with your home’s theme and personal flair.

Maintaining Your RTA Closet
Proper maintenance can extend the lifespan of your RTA closet. Regular dusting and ensuring it’s not overloaded are good practices. For specific finishes, using appropriate cleaning products will keep your closet looking pristine for years.
